I can't play some tracks. They're appearing greyed out and it is telling me that they are not available in my country. A couple weeks before deezer also was showing me message with an error MS2002. 

 

It started a month before after several updates. And I can't play them on all of my devices: web browser, desktop windows 11, android and on IOS ipad. 

 

For example, I can't listen to the music of Hans Zimmer and specifically his album Pirates of the Caribbean At World's end. Yet I can perfectly load his other music and POTC soundtrack to other chapters. And I've been using deezer almost for 10 years now which feels very weird and disappointing to have this problem with soundtracks that I have listened for hundred times.

Tracks on Deezer are typically greyed out because they are temporarily or permanently unavailable for streaming due to expired licensing agreements, regional restrictions, or if you have enabled filters to hide explicit content. These songs may return, or you might find them by searching for the same song on a different album.
